Loads of Sheffield United fans have reacted to a tweet from the club's official Twitter account, as Friday marked 17 years to the day since Paul Peschisolido's iconic goal against Nottingham Forest in the Division One play-offs.  

Whatever your opinions may be on the Canadian, it is fair to say Peschisolido scored plenty of stunning goals throughout his career, but it is his solo run that has supporters drooling on Twitter.

The Blades tweeted footage of his goal in the second leg of the playoff semi-final, an effort that gave the South Yorkshire outfit a narrow 3-2 lead. Taking a long ball from goalkeeper Paddy Kenny, 'Pesch' went on a "mazy run" and struck a low finish into the bottom corner of the net. Neil Warnock's side went on to win the tie 4-3, and the striker's heroic display certainly stole the show (Examiner).

Peschisolido scored 19 goals in 83 appearances for United, before leaving for Derby County on a free transfer all the way back in 2004.

Clearly, loads of fans still haven't forgotten about the performance, as many raved over the "fantastic" video on social media. One fan even suggested he was "better than Messi on his day."
